In honour of the 75th anniversary of the Liberation of the Netherlands, the Dutch Liberation 2020 Canadian Society has created a temporary display chronicling the liberation of the Netherlands by Canadian Armed Forces. The exhibition covers the Dutch experience under Nazi occupation, how the Canadians helped the Dutch by providing a safe haven for the Royal Family and how the Canadian Forces liberated the Netherlands from the Germans.

The exhibition also explores the immigration of Dutch citizens to Canada and the legacy of how the Dutch and Dutch-Canadians have worked to honour the Canadian effort to free the Netherlands during WWII. 

Artifacts featured in the exhibition include souvenirs documenting how the liberation has been recognized over the past 75 years and two examples of souvenirs that were brought back from the Netherlands by Canadians involved in the liberation.
